Pushpa 2 Dominates Box Office While Baby John Struggles
Sukumar’s directorial masterpiece, Pushpa 2: The Rule, starring Allu Arjun, Rashmika Mandanna, and Fahadh Faasil, has achieved an extraordinary milestone at the box office. According to Sacnilk, the film has collected a staggering ₹1156.85 crore net in India by the end of its fourth weekend. Released on December 5, the movie continues its phenomenal run, breaking records and outperforming all competitors.
On the other hand, Varun Dhawan’s action thriller Baby John, which hit theatres during the Christmas weekend, has failed to make a mark. Despite the holiday release, the film couldn’t generate momentum at the box office, struggling to cross ₹30 crore after its extended five-day opening weekend.
Baby John Falls Short
The Varun Dhawan and Keerthy Suresh starrer opened to a lukewarm response, earning ₹11.24 crore on its first day. Unfortunately, the film saw a sharp decline in collections, managing only ₹4.75 crore on its second day and an additional ₹4.75 crore on Sunday, as per Sacnilk. The film’s underwhelming storyline and weak audience reception contributed to its disappointing performance.
Pushpa 2: The Rule Reigns Supreme
In stark contrast, Pushpa 2: The Rule continues to dominate. On its fourth Sunday alone, the film collected ₹15.5 crore net in India. Its total earnings have soared to ₹1156.85 crore in just 25 days. The Allu Arjun starrer recorded a 42% jump in collections on Saturday, bringing in ₹12.5 crore, further cementing its position as a box office juggernaut.
The film has already surpassed expectations and is aiming to achieve ₹750 crore in its Hindi version alone. With no significant competition at the Hindi box office until Republic Day 2025, Pushpa 2: The Rule has emerged as the top contender, beating out competitors like Shraddha Kapoor’s Stree 2.
